The content of your conclusion paragraph is what you will leave your readers with as you sign off. It is a mark of … first time and company clocksWebApr 3, 2024 · 5 Overused Conclusion Sentences. Oftentimes, students tend to rely on certain conclusion sentences and transitions more so than others. Most teachers would advise that if they had a dime for every time a student used the transition "In conclusion" to start their concluding paragraph, that they'd be rich.
